*Edit: The Fallout series had a pretty good barter system. Like, sure, there was money in the form of bottle caps. However, scavenging the wastes, and trading the crap you find for things you'd actually use (mostly ammo and medical supplies) was generally how players "shop" in that series.

Probably Elder Scrolls games as well? I played a bit of Arena back in the day, and a bit of Oblivion. The barter system of Oblivion looked/felt similar enough to Fallout 3's. Bethesda may had just acquired the rights to the Fallout IP at that point, so, perhaps this was done on purpose.
